
If your fridge freezer isn't freezing, it could be due to several reasons. First, check if the freezer is properly set to the correct temperature, typically around 0°F (-18°C). If the settings are correct but the freezer still isn't freezing, it might be an issue with the door seal. A damaged or improperly sealed door can cause cold air to escape, preventing the freezer from reaching the desired temperature. Another possibility is a malfunction in the freezer's cooling system, such as a problem with the compressor, condenser coils, or evaporator coils. It's also worth checking if there's any ice buildup in the freezer, as this can interfere with the cooling process. If you've tried these basic troubleshooting steps and the issue persists, it may be time to consult a professional appliance repair technician to diagnose and fix the problem.

Temperature Settings: Check if the temperature settings are correct and adjusted properly for freezing
The temperature settings of your fridge freezer play a crucial role in ensuring that your food is stored at the correct temperature for safety and preservation. If your fridge freezer is not freezing properly, the first step should be to check the temperature settings. Most modern fridge freezers come with digital displays that show the current temperature inside both the fridge and freezer compartments. Ensure that the freezer is set to a temperature of 0°F (-18°C) or below, which is the optimal temperature for freezing food.
If the temperature settings appear to be correct but the freezer is still not freezing, it may be necessary to adjust the settings slightly. Some fridge freezers have a manual override feature that allows you to adjust the temperature settings beyond the preset options. In this case, try lowering the temperature setting by a few degrees and see if this resolves the issue.
It's also important to note that the temperature inside the freezer can be affected by a number of factors, including the amount of food stored inside, the frequency of door opening, and the ambient temperature in the room where the fridge freezer is located. If you live in a particularly warm climate or if the fridge freezer is located in a room with high temperatures, you may need to set the temperature slightly lower to compensate.
In addition to checking the temperature settings, it's a good idea to check the door seals to ensure that they are clean and free of any debris that could prevent the door from closing properly. A faulty door seal can cause the freezer to work harder to maintain the correct temperature, which can lead to increased energy consumption and potential damage to the appliance.
Finally, if you have checked the temperature settings and door seals and are still experiencing issues with your fridge freezer not freezing properly, it may be necessary to contact a professional appliance repair technician to diagnose and resolve the problem. They will be able to provide expert advice and guidance on how to get your fridge freezer working properly again.

Door Seal: Inspect the door seal for any damage or gaps that could let cold air escape
A damaged or compromised door seal is one of the most common reasons a fridge freezer may fail to maintain the desired temperature. The seal, also known as a gasket, is responsible for creating an airtight barrier when the door is closed, preventing cold air from escaping and warm air from entering. Over time, the seal can wear out, crack, or become misaligned, leading to inefficiencies in the cooling system.
To inspect the door seal, start by visually examining it for any obvious signs of damage, such as cracks, tears, or discoloration. Next, run your hand along the length of the seal to check for any gaps or irregularities. If you find any issues, it's important to address them promptly to prevent further temperature fluctuations.
In some cases, a damaged seal may be repairable with a simple replacement or adjustment. However, if the damage is extensive or the seal is no longer pliable, it may be necessary to replace the entire door. When replacing a seal, be sure to choose one that is compatible with your specific fridge freezer model and follow the manufacturer's instructions for installation.
Regular maintenance of the door seal can help prevent future issues. This includes cleaning the seal with a mild detergent and water solution to remove any dirt or debris that may have accumulated, and lubricating it with a silicone-based lubricant to ensure it remains flexible and effective.
By taking the time to inspect and maintain your fridge freezer's door seal, you can help ensure that it operates efficiently and effectively, keeping your food safe and fresh for as long as possible.

Frost Buildup: Excessive frost can prevent proper freezing; check for frost and defrost if necessary
Frost buildup inside a freezer can significantly impede its freezing capabilities. When frost accumulates on the walls, shelves, and other surfaces, it acts as an insulator, preventing the cold air from circulating efficiently and reaching the food items stored within. This can lead to uneven freezing, longer freezing times, and potentially spoiled food. To address this issue, it's essential to regularly check for frost buildup and defrost the freezer if necessary.
To determine if frost buildup is the culprit behind your freezer's poor performance, open the freezer door and inspect the interior. Look for a white, crystalline layer on the surfaces, which is indicative of frost. If you notice a significant amount of frost, it's time to defrost the freezer. Before proceeding, remove all food items and store them in a cooler or another freezer to prevent spoilage.
Defrosting a freezer can be done using a few different methods. One common approach is to simply leave the freezer door open and allow the frost to melt naturally. This method can take several hours, depending on the amount of frost and the room temperature. To speed up the process, you can place a bowl of hot water inside the freezer or use a hairdryer on a low setting. Be cautious not to use any electrical appliances near water to avoid the risk of electric shock.
Once the frost has melted, wipe down the interior surfaces with a sponge or cloth to remove any remaining moisture. It's also a good idea to clean the freezer thoroughly at this point, using a mild detergent and warm water. After cleaning, dry the surfaces completely before replacing the food items.
To prevent future frost buildup, ensure that the freezer door is sealed properly and that the temperature is set correctly. It's also important to avoid overloading the freezer, as this can restrict air circulation and contribute to frost formation. Regularly checking for frost and defrosting as needed will help maintain the efficiency and effectiveness of your freezer, ensuring that your food stays frozen and fresh.

Compressor Issues: A malfunctioning compressor can affect freezing; listen for unusual noises or vibrations
A malfunctioning compressor is a common culprit behind a fridge freezer's failure to freeze properly. The compressor is responsible for circulating the refrigerant throughout the system, and if it's not functioning correctly, the refrigerant won't be able to absorb and release heat efficiently. This can lead to a buildup of heat in the freezer compartment, preventing it from reaching the desired temperature.
One of the first signs of a compressor issue is unusual noises or vibrations coming from the fridge. If you notice any loud clunking, hissing, or rattling sounds, or if the fridge seems to be vibrating excessively, it's likely that the compressor is to blame. These noises and vibrations can be caused by a variety of issues, such as a loose component, a failing motor, or a refrigerant leak.
To diagnose the problem, start by unplugging the fridge and removing the back panel to access the compressor. Check for any visible signs of damage or wear, such as cracks, rust, or burnt wires. If you don't see any obvious issues, you may need to use a multimeter to test the compressor's electrical components. If the compressor is found to be faulty, it will need to be replaced by a professional technician.
In addition to unusual noises and vibrations, there are a few other signs that may indicate a compressor issue. If your fridge freezer is not freezing properly, but the temperature in the fridge compartment seems to be unaffected, it's likely that the compressor is the problem. You may also notice that the freezer is frosting up excessively, or that the fridge is running continuously without cycling off.
To prevent compressor issues, it's important to keep your fridge clean and well-maintained. Regularly clean the condenser coils, check the door seals for any gaps or damage, and ensure that the fridge is properly leveled. By taking these steps, you can help to prolong the life of your compressor and prevent costly repairs.
In conclusion, if your fridge freezer is not freezing properly, it's important to consider the possibility of a compressor issue. Listen for unusual noises or vibrations, and look for other signs of malfunction. If you suspect that the compressor is to blame, it's best to consult with a professional technician to diagnose and repair the problem.

Air Circulation: Ensure proper air circulation inside the freezer by checking for blocked vents or shelves
Proper air circulation is crucial for the efficient operation of your freezer. If you've noticed that your fridge freezer isn't freezing as it should, one of the first things to check is whether there are any obstructions to the airflow inside the unit. Blocked vents or shelves can significantly impede the circulation of cold air, leading to uneven cooling and potential spoilage of food.
To ensure optimal air circulation, start by removing all items from the freezer and inspecting the vents and shelves for any debris or ice buildup. Ice can form around the vents, particularly if the door has been left open for extended periods or if there's high humidity in the room. Use a hairdryer on a low setting to gently melt any ice, being careful not to damage the internal components of the freezer.
Next, check the arrangement of the shelves and baskets. Ensure that there is adequate space between each shelf to allow cold air to flow freely. If you have items that are too large or oddly shaped, consider rearranging them or using storage containers to optimize the use of space. Additionally, make sure that the shelves themselves are not damaged or warped, as this can also hinder airflow.
Once you've cleared any obstructions and rearranged the contents of your freezer, it's important to maintain good air circulation practices. Regularly clean the vents and shelves to prevent ice buildup, and avoid overloading the freezer with too many items. Keeping the door closed as much as possible will also help maintain a consistent temperature and reduce the risk of ice formation.
In conclusion, ensuring proper air circulation inside your freezer is a simple yet effective way to address issues with freezing. By regularly checking for blocked vents or shelves and maintaining good practices, you can help keep your freezer running efficiently and protect your food from spoilage.
